OK I have an 02 dakota 4x4 V8 Magnum. When Going down the interstate it will rev up about 3 or 4 hundred RPM's out of the blue. It does it on flat ground, or going up a hill either one. When I turn the cruise on it gets even worse. IT's mostly intermitent without the cruise but with it it's rev then back down, rev then back down, etc. without the cruise it's about 30 seconds or so and when it does it it'll do it 3 or 4 times in a row. any ideas? Also, this truck should fine for pulling a boat shouldn't it?

Key on off on off on (not to start, just on) will display any stored codes in your odometer window; ending with "pdone". A bad TPS could be causing the torque converter to be going in and out of lock up.
